#93288c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93288c is composed of 57.6% red, 15.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 303.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 36.7%. #93288c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#270019.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#93288c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93288c has RGB values of R:147, G:40,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.05,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9644172.

Shades and Tints of #93288c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080208 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#93288c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615a60 is the less saturated color, while #b704ab is the most saturated one.
